Transaction ddd6475fab9130646ccbeaa63b729d1aede4f1a09cc74f564bbd45e7a0224191
1 Input
1 Output
-
ddd6475fab9130646ccbeaa63b729d1aede4f1a09cc74f564bbd45e7a0224191:0
- value
- 234277
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1a4558b1764cd45aba44e652a0c76b176960d21 OP_EQUAL
- address
- 3KLuCho9rdpk8E1Gi1Wyv8gntxWqEz3auS